Job Description

The Electrical Engineer will be responsible for designing and overseeing power distribution, lighting, and fire alarm systems for commercial, industrial, and institutional projects. While design expertise is the core focus, candidates with field experience in system installation, troubleshooting, or commissioning will be highly valued.

Key Responsibilities
Design electrical power distribution, lighting, fire alarm, and low-voltage systems for various building types
Perform load calculations, short-circuit analysis, arc flash studies, and coordination studies using ETAP or similar software
Develop and modify electrical drawings and BIM models in Revit and AutoCAD
Ensure designs comply with NEC, NFPA, IECC, and local codes and standards
Work closely with the entire project team and key stakeholders to integrate electrical systems with the overall project design
Review submittals, shop drawings, and specifications for electrical systems
Conduct site visits for installation reviews, system evaluations, and commissioning support.

Required Skills & Experience

Bachelor's Degree in Electrical Engineering or related field
PE License in Illinois
Minimum 10 years demonstrated electrical engineering experience
Proficiency in Revit and AutoCAD for electrical system design
Experience with ETAP or similar power system analysis software
Strong knowledge of power distribution, low-voltage, lighting, and fire alarm design
Familiarity with NEC, NFPA, energy codes, and industry standards
Proficiency in Bluebeam Revu for markup, document management, and collaboration
Field experience in system installation, troubleshooting, or commissioning is a strong plus
Ability to perform quality reviews for detailed engineering documents and specifications
Demonstrated attention to detail, facilitation, team building, collaboration, organization and problem-solving skills
Strong anal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ills
